Compost helps soil soak up stormwater long after construction

If you've ever watched rain pool and run off a newly landscaped yard instead of sinking in, working compost into that compacted soil at a generous rate is a fix backed by six months of real data.
Construction often leaves soil squashed and hard, so rain just runs off instead of soaking in. Researchers mixed different amounts of compost into two soil types and tested how fast water infiltrated over six months. They found that mixing in at least 30% compost by volume made a lasting difference, letting water soak in up to 10 times faster than untreated soil, and the improvement held up for months rather than fading quickly.
Key Findings
Compost incorporation at 30% and 50% rates (by volume) significantly increased porosity, field capacity, and plant-available water while decreasing bulk and particle density.
Infiltration rates were about 10x, 5x, and 1.5x higher than untreated soil for 50%, 30%, and 15% compost rates respectively.
Infiltration improvements stabilized after about two months but remained sustained for the full six-month study; compost type (woodchip-food waste vs. poultry manure-food waste) had no significant effect.

Mixing a good amount of compost into disturbed, compacted soil can help rainwater soak in up to 10 times faster, which could help cities manage stormwater and reduce flooding after construction projects.
